The ends of a filter element are sealed using potting compound and plastic endcaps. The upper endcap, which is closed, has a pressure relief aperture associated therewith to prevent bowing. In a plugged filter condition the high-downward pressure introduced on the upper endcap is compensated by providing the cartridge with centering ribs which bottom on an associated ledge in the housing to provide a positive stop for the top endcap, preventing it from being driven down into and through the filter element. Rubber gaskets are associated with the respective endcaps, and are reliably secured to the endcaps by being snap fit into grooves molded into the plastic of the endcaps. The lower endcap utilizes a simple radial seal gasket which is both highly effective and also positioned to avoid structural crushing forces on the cartridge. A keying system prevents the installation of improper filters.

    Abstract: An environmentally friendly dual lube venturi filter cartridge which has no metallic components. A plastic centertube having a venturi section supports a bypass filter element on standoffs molded into the centertube. An outer concentric full flow filter element surrounds the bypass filter. The full flow filter is supported on a plastic centertube which creates a gap between it and the bypass filter. A first bypass filter endcap both seals the bypass filter and provides standoffs for allowing full flow oil around the bypass filter. The standoffs thus split the full flow which progresses through the primary filter in two paths, a primary path around the bypass filter and into the centertube, and a bypass path through the secondary filter and the venturi. Plastic upper and lower endcaps carry grooves for simple sealing gaskets, a radial seal gasket on the bottom which seals against both the endcap which carries it and a flange in the housing, and an axial seal gasket at the top.

    Abstract: With known devices for separating oil in the crank housing ventilator, oil is collected on a refined gas side of a filter, which in operation of an internal combustion engine, often cannot drain off. In this manner, the liquid level increases, so that the filter is increasingly clogged by the oil. Finally, the oil is carried away from a gas stream. In this manner, the oil use of the internal combustion engine greatly increases. With the device of the present invention, the oil collected on the refined gas side is collected in a liquid storage unit (10), whereby the liquid storage unit (10) is protected from the stream, so that the gas stream can not carry away oil any longer. The device includes a support body (9), which is impermeable to the stream by means of a cut-off wall (23), in order to prevent a carrying-off of the oil.
